  • County backs 2017 Bassmaster tourney

    Updated Nov 15, 2016

    For The Record- Dave Rogers Fish was on the menu for the Orange County Commissioners Tuesday and they were plenty anxious to reel in some economic benefit. Commissioners voted 4-0 to authorize spending $90,000 in Hotel/Motel Occupancy funds to promote the 2017 Bass Pro Shops Bassmaster Open fishing tournament staging from the Orange Boat Ramp June 15-17. “The cost-benefit analysis is off the chart,” declared Jody Crump, Precinct 4 Commissioner.
